THIS IS A TITLE 5 EXCEPTED NATIONAL GUARD POSITION
This position is located at an ANG Security Forces Flight.

The primary purpose of this position is to serve as a first level supervisor and/or flight chief, providing planning, directing, organizing, and exercising control over nonsupervisory employees assigned to the Security Forces Flight.


MAJOR DUTIES:

  • Exercises supervisory personnel management responsibilities. Advises and provides counsel to employees regarding policies, procedures, and directives of management.
  • Represents the Security Forces Flight with a variety of functional area organizations. Establishes, develops, and maintains effective working relationships with the base community.
  • Performs and enforces the full range of police officer duties within the military facility.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.

Qualifications:


SPECIALIZED EXPERIENCE:


Months Required: 18 Months


Experience that provided knowledge of a body of basic laws and regulations, law enforcement operations, practices, and techniques and involved responsibility for maintaining order and protecting life and property.

Creditable specialized experience may have been gained in work on a police force; through service as a military police officer; in work providing visitor protection and law enforcement in parks, forests, or other natural resource or recreational environments; in performing criminal investigative duties; or in other work that provided the required knowledge and skills.

Experience in managing the function of the work to be performed. Experience which includes leading, directing and assigning work of personnel.


Education:


No substitution of education allowed for this position.
